Role & Responsibilities
- Assist product development managers in the tailoring and pants/shirts categories.
- Update tracking documents such as collection plans and VIP order tables.
- Participate in fittings with designers, the design office, and the workshop.
- Aid in the creation and updating of models using the PLM tool.
- Generate model/material allocation sheets for launches.
- Support the dispatch of components and fabrics to manufacturers.
- Independently manage the development of covered buttons with the Parisian workshop.
- Create fabric boards for the collection.
- Assist in the reception of prototypes, including unwrapping, checking, and hanger changes.
- Support the tracking of VIP orders.
- Print product labels.
- Handle DHL shipments and courier bookings.
- Scan collection looks for the looklist.
- Monitor the creation of toiles and mock-ups by the workshop.
- Send prototypes to manufacturers.
